What's the easiest way to see the current changelog and/or svn source
version for pre-compiled .deb packages (before installation)? I often
run trunk versions of code that have patches from myself or other
maintainers applied, and I would like to know when new debian packages
are ready to install, whether or not it's worth my time to download and
install them, and if I do, if I can remove my patched version built from
source.

I looked around and couldn't find any changleogs or .deb version info on
the wiki or repository pool site.
